Skin Type Compatibility

Choosing the right salicylic acid spot treatment depends on your skin type. For oily or combination skin, use formulas with ingredients like witch hazel or zinc PCA. These ingredients control oil and fight pimples effectively. For sensitive skin, look for soothing ingredients such as aloe or niacinamide. Avoid products with fragrances or alcohol, as they can cause irritation. Dry skin needs treatments with hydrating components like hyaluronic acid or ceramides. Always test a small amount of the product before regular use. Picking the correct treatment helps you clear pimples faster and maintain healthy skin. Match your skin type with the right ingredients for the best results.

Concentration Levels

Finding the right salicylic acid spot treatment depends on your skin’s needs. Concentrations usually range from 0.5% to 2%. A 0.5% formula is gentle and helps fight pimples without irritating dry or sensitive skin. If you have stubborn or cystic pimples, a 2% treatment can work faster to clear your skin. Keep in mind, higher concentrations can cause more dryness or peeling. Choose your strength based on how severe your acne is and how your skin reacts. With the correct concentration, you can see clearer skin and feel more confident.

Ingredient Combinations

Choosing the right ingredients for a salicylic acid spot treatment helps fight pimples without irritating your skin. Salicylic acid works well with niacinamide. This combination calms the skin and reduces pore size. For extra soothing, pick products with witch hazel or tea tree oil. These ingredients reduce inflammation and help prevent breakouts. Avoid mixing salicylic acid with other strong exfoliants like glycolic or lactic acid. Too much exfoliation can dry out your skin. For irritation relief, look for formulas with chamomile or zinc PCA. These ingredients soothe inflamed skin. Also, use moisturizers with hyaluronic acid. They hydrate your skin while treating pimples. The right combination of ingredients keeps your skin balanced. It helps get clearer, healthier skin.

Application Frequency

Have you wondered how often you should use salicylic acid spot treatments? Most products suggest applying up to three times a day. However, this might not suit everyone. If your skin is sensitive, start with once or twice daily. This reduces the risk of dryness and irritation. Always try to apply the treatment at the same times each day. This helps your skin get used to it and gives consistent results. Do not use more than recommended. Overusing salicylic acid can cause problems instead of helping. Watch how your skin reacts and adjust the frequency if needed. When used correctly, salicylic acid can effectively clear pimples without causing too much dryness or irritation.

Sensitivity Precautions

If you have sensitive skin, choosing a mild salicylic acid treatment is important. Use a low concentration, such as 0.5%, to reduce the chance of irritation while still fighting pimples. Before applying it all over your face, do a patch test to check for reactions. Look for soothing ingredients like witch hazel or aloe, which can calm and protect sensitive skin. Avoid applying salicylic acid too often, as this can cause redness or peeling. Do not combine multiple salicylic acid products or use harsh scrubs, because they can irritate your skin. Follow these tips to keep your skin healthy and clear.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can Salicylic Acid Spot Treatments Cause Skin Dryness or Irritation?

Yes, salicylic acid spot treatments can cause dryness or irritation, especially if you have sensitive skin or use them too frequently. To minimize side effects, start with a low concentration and apply only to affected areas.

How Long Should I Wait to See Results From These Treatments?

You should start noticing improvements within 3 to 7 days of using the treatment regularly. Be patient, avoid over-applying, and keep a consistent routine to see the best results and prevent irritation or dryness.

Are These Treatments Suitable for Sensitive Skin Types?

Yes, these treatments can be suitable for sensitive skin if you choose formulations labeled for sensitive skin. Always do a patch test first and start with a lower concentration to minimize irritation and assess how your skin reacts.

Can I Use Salicylic Acid Treatments With Other Skincare Products?

Yes, you can combine salicylic acid treatments with other skincare products, but you should patch test first and avoid using multiple exfoliants simultaneously. Always follow product instructions and consult a dermatologist if unsure about compatibility.

What Is the Best Frequency for Applying Salicylic Acid Spot Treatments?

You should apply salicylic acid spot treatments once or twice daily, depending on your skin’s tolerance. Start with once daily, monitor your skin, and adjust frequency to avoid irritation while effectively treating pimples.
